Understanding Buddhism

Origins, Beliefs, Practices, Holy Texts, Sacred Places

In this book Malcolm David Eckel, Professor of Religion at Boston University, gives a short but concise introduction to one of the world's great religious traditions - Buddhism. Buddhist thoughts and concepts are spreading steadily throughout the Western world and the need for good and precise information is growing equally. Accompanied by a number of high quality pictures of Buddhist art and architecture, the book presents the key themes of the Buddhist faith. It gives the historic facts of the life of the Buddha, the early spreading of Buddhism throughout Asia and includes the current spread to the Western world as well as spiritual teachings, rituals and ceremonies. It quotes from sacred texts, explains central concepts such as karma, meditation, enlightenment, death and reincarnation.

It also presents selected texts with commentary to explain the original meaning as well as interpretations and their relation to modern Buddhism. In short the book offers a very good introduction to the central ideas in Buddhism.
